This is a *great* feature that it'd be really cool for Ubuntu to have
and I'm very pleased that the team has been working on it, but...

I really don't feel very good about this freeze exception request. It
doesn't seem right to me to be adding unmerged, experimental and
unfinished features into the release - especially so late on.

It is going to need iteration either before or after the release and
that runs a very high risk of either being disruptive to the release
(making updates to the altered packages potentially more difficult if
they need to be changed for other reasons), taking up time of the
release/SRU teams having to review changes, or (if iterations aren't
included in disco) the package in the release being behind the latest
developments meaning that it ends up not being as useful to people as it
could be — known bugs will be fixed in the development branches but not
in disco.

A PPA seems like the right place to handle distributing such
experimental features to people. Testing things is one thing that PPAs
are for, and any publicity that you want to do around this feature could
have upgrading via `add-apt-repository` as its first step. Such a PPA
could even live under an uploading team like ~ubuntu-desktop to make it
seem more official if you wanted.

There's no problem with ubuntu/disco-x-fractional branches being created
in the packaging repositories, to make handling the PPA easier.

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to gnome-control-center in Ubuntu.
https://bugs.launchpad.net/bugs/1820850

Title:
  [FFe] Distro patch GNOME hi-dpi support for x11 sessions

Status in gnome-control-center package in Ubuntu:
  New
Status in gnome-shell package in Ubuntu:
  New

Bug description:
  The first part of our work on better handling of HI-DPI screens got merged 
upstream in 3.32, but it's for wayland only
  
https://blog.3v1n0.net/informatica/linux/gnome-shell-fractional-scaling-in-wayland-landed/

  Since our default session in Ubuntu is based on xorg we would like to
  distro patch the x11 equivalent for Disco so our users can benefit
  from the feature.

  Updates packages are up for testing in that ppa
  https://launchpad.net/~3v1n0/+archive/ubuntu/mutter-x11-fractional-scaling

  The main change is
  
https://launchpadlibrarian.net/415722066/mutter_3.32.0-1_3.32.0-1ubuntu1~xrandrscaling3.diff.gz

  The ppa also includes a bugfix and a settings change to allow easy
  configuration.

  Note that the feature is behind an experimental gsettings key and the code 
has no impact on the rendering for users who don't enable it, which means it 
shouldn't be too risk. It's available as a opt-in for those who want to test it.
  From our testing it works fine and we feel like it's ready to be included. We 
do plan to get that work merged upstream in the next cycle so it should not be 
an Ubuntu delta to carry over forever.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/gnome-control-center/+bug/1820850/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to     :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to